Self-perceived health by sex, age and education - from 35 to 44 years - less than primary, primary and lower secondary education (levels 0-2) - bad - females reached 11.2% in 2015 in Estonia, according to . This is 17.9% more than in the previous year.
Historically, Self-perceived Health by Sex, Age and Education - From 35 to 44 years - Less than primary, primary and lower secondary education (levels 0-2) - Bad - Females in Estonia reached an all time high of 22.7% in 2006 and an all time low of 5.00% in 2009.
Estonia has been ranked 7th within the group of 31 countries we follow in terms of Self-perceived Health by Sex, Age and Education - From 35 to 44 years - Less than primary, primary and lower secondary education (levels 0-2) - Bad - Females.
